News
Impact Plastics Inc. officials exercised reasonable diligence in dismissing employees and directing them to leave the Erwin, Tenn., site as flood waters rose from Hurricane Helene on Sept.
Results that may be inaccessible to you are currently showing.
Hide inaccessible results